Joint Money Laundering Task Forces (JMLTFs)
- The establishment of JMLTFs in various cities has streamlined the process for sharing information and coordinating efforts between agencies.
- These task forces are helping to trace the proceeds of illegal activities back to their sources, making it harder for criminals to hide their ill-gotten gains.
International Collaborations
- Organizations like the Egmont Group of FIUs enable the sharing of real-time financial intelligence and foster a global network of expertise.
- This intelligence data not only strengthens ongoing investigations but also provides vital insights for preventative measures.
